Coffee cups a plenty for charity

LOCAL bobbies joined charity fund-raisers in lifting their mugs for the World's Biggest Coffee Morning.

PCSOs from the Mottingham Safer Neighbourhood police team popped into Mottingham Community Learning Shop for a cuppa in aid of Macmillan Cancer Support.

The centre, in Cranley Parade, Beaconsfield Road, runs community courses in basic skills and hosts surgeries by ward councillors and police officers.

Macmillan hopes to make £7million from the nationwide event to support sufferers and their families.

Last year, two million people raised their cups - with every one helping to improve the lives of people with cancer.
